Transaction d96a6d8b26ff24caed1ef155a1dd3306abe3513c8a43f8963a28fbc988e776f5
1 Input
1 Output
-
d96a6d8b26ff24caed1ef155a1dd3306abe3513c8a43f8963a28fbc988e776f5:0
- value
- 580000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9304365f63e8664a03493e345af3cc3ecd757bae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EQMNt7bacET8qTNEUiaXZgjEJD9jTKjhj